A single serving of yellow wax beans is 3/4 cup (or 85 grams). One serving of yellow wax beans has the following nutrients, according to the USDA: Calories : 24.6. Total fat : 0 g. Cholesterol : 0 mg. Sodium : 5.1 mg. Total carbs : 6 g. Dietary fiber : 2.98 g.

WebLooking at the nutrition information between canned and fresh green beans revealed that the nutritional content is pretty similar between the two. However, one of the primary differences is sodium content, with canned green beans having more than fresh vegetables.
